Pegasus, Net Trans Extend Commission Processing Pact

Thursday, 20/11/2008

Pegasus Solutions, Inc. and Net Trans Services AS have extended an agreement to maximize the commissions travel agents receive from thousands of hotels worldwide. Pegasus and Net Trans extended for three years the partnership begun in November 2006 to help agents increase income, cut costs and streamline processes.

 

Relais & Chateaux Switches to SynXis’ RedX DMS

Monday, 17/11/2008

Following a tender involving six service providers, Relais & Chateaux has selected SynXis, a subsidiary of the worldwide travel marketplace leader Sabre Holdings, as its international reservations provider.

New Tourism Scholarship Opportunity

A scholarship opportunity may soon become available for Caribbean residents who work in the tourism industry. This development is the result of a donation by the Florida-Caribbean Cruise Association of $10,000 to the Caribbean Tourism Organization (CTO) Foundation, Inc.

More Cruise Ships to Visit Panama

Since Panama signed an agreement with cruise ships companies, which are members of the Florida Caribbean Cruise Association in October 2000, the arrival of passengers to the Panamanian ports of Gatun, Colon 2000, Cristobal, Balboa, Fuerte Amador and Kuna Yala has increased, which confirm the status of the country as an established tourist destination.

Priceline Pays Fine for Breaking Cuba Sanctions

Priceline.com Inc. has become at least the second online travel company to get slapped with a fine from the U.S. federal government for violating the longstanding sanctions on Cuba.
